Transaction 2fd31afbea0d3fb6190c900ccff619df04699acbcd30594401743bedb241950c

block
617bd0e9061818557a8eb4ec8c8dc1c9a6730fc546dd48420d5186f4159b3587

1 Input

3000 Outputs